Yes, for the University of British Columbia admissions at UG level, a class 12th result from CBSE, ISC or State Board is accepted. 

This admission process is surely quite competitive and it will require these CBSE students to have a minimum score of 85 to 88%.

Indian applicants also need high scores in relevant subjects like English and Mathematics.

Indian applicants can apply for the University of British Columbia admissions with the predicted grades or the mid-year results, if their 12th board final results are not announced before the UBC admission decisions. 

If an applicant is selected for admission to this university, then the student should submit the final 12 board marksheets by July as per the UBC admission deadlines.

Yes, Cummins College of Engineering for Women, Pune is only for female students. Cummins College of Engineering for Women Karvenagar, Pune is an autonomous college  (accredited with A Grade by NAAC) which is affiliated with the Savitribai Phule Pune University. MKSSS's Cummins College of Engineering for Women is approved by AICTE & Directorate of Technical Education, Maharashtra state, Mumbai.

Yes UB campus can be considered to be extremely safe. There are about 1,000 security cameras across all three campuses and UB has a police department called UBPD patrolling the campus which ensures that laws and regulations defined by the  NYS Criminal Procedure Law and Education Law of New York State are enforced

RR Institute of Technology placements are good. The key placement highlights of RRIT Bangalore are mentioned below:

Particulars

BTech Placement Statistics 2024

the highest package

INR 4.2 LPA

Median package

INR 3 LPA

Total students

170

Students placed

116

Total offers

168
